Fremde Haut

Good flick we just checked out (was made in 05 though).
The English name is Unveiled, but the original name Fremde Haut is way cooler sounding, let's face it.
Main character Fariba Tabrizi seeks asylum in Germany to avoided being persecuted in Iran for a lesbian relationship. After numerous failed attempts Fariba takes on the identity of a dead man to get in and that's how the story unfolds.
I just fell in love with Germany, so I might be a little biased on saying this film is good, but I think it holds it's own in the drama category. Jasmin Tabatabai (who plays Fariba) does an outstanding job and it's shot with such detail, any filmmaker could appreciate it for that if the story can lag in parts.
